Digital Ticket Transfer & Resale Experience Survey
Measures event attendees' perceptions of clarity, fairness, and friction in digital ticket transfer and resale processes to identify platform improvement priorities.

Why this template
- Purpose-built to measure clarity of transfer/resale fees, deadlines, and payment timing rather than just collect registration data
- Captures fairness perceptions separately from clarity (overall fairness, fee fairness, fairest pricing approach) to help prioritize fixes
- Includes a ranked-improvements question and open-text prompt on barriers/frustrations to surface concrete platform priorities
- Adds an AI follow-up interview to probe respondents' most recent transfer/resale experience in their own words, going beyond fixed-choice answers
